Seasonal Pricing — Peak vs. Shoulder vs. Off-Season in North Europe
North Europe experiences notable seasonal fluctuations in luxury RV rental prices. Understanding these variations is key to planning a cost-effective trip.
The peak season, typically spanning July and August, sees the highest demand due to the most favorable weather for exploration, resulting in the highest rental prices. These rates are dynamic and change on a daily basis.
Shoulder seasons, generally May to June and September to October, offer a sweet spot. You’ll benefit from pleasant weather suitable for touring and more moderate prices, making it a cost-effective choice.
The off-season, from November to April, is usually the cheapest time to rent an RV, with April often presenting the lowest rates. However, RVs rented during this period must be adequately equipped for colder weather, including potential snow and ice, which can influence the available vehicle classes and their features.

Hidden Costs to Budget For in North Europe
Beyond the daily rental rate, several ancillary costs are essential to factor into your North European RV adventure budget.
Tolls are a significant consideration, particularly in countries like Norway, Sweden, and Denmark, which often have automated toll systems. It’s advisable to research options for pre-purchasing toll passes or understanding how these fees are managed to avoid unexpected charges or fines.
Campsite fees represent another substantial expense, especially for larger luxury RVs that typically require full hook-ups. Exploring options for discount camping cards, if offered by your rental provider, can help mitigate these costs.
Fuel costs in North Europe are among the highest in Europe, so factoring this into your daily budget is critical. Additionally, some service points for waste disposal may charge fees for grey and black water disposal.

How much does it cost to rent an RV in Europe
Renting an RV in North Europe generally incurs higher costs compared to Southern or Eastern European destinations. This is attributed to the region's higher cost of living and the demand for vehicles well-equipped for specific climates and terrains.
Daily rental rates for a standard RV in North Europe can range from approximately €80 during off-peak periods to over €250 during peak season. Luxury RV models, however, start at a higher price point, typically from €150 per day and can easily exceed €500 daily during the busiest months.
These figures are heavily influenced by the season, the RV's class, the rental duration, and the specific country within North Europe, with Norway and Iceland often being at the higher end of the price spectrum.
It's crucial to remember that these rental rates do not include significant additional expenses such as fuel, tolls, campsite fees, and comprehensive insurance, all of which substantially impact the total trip budget. What is the 333 rule for campervan
The '333 rule' is a popular guideline for campervan travel, recommending drivers aim to travel no more than 3 hours, cover approximately 300 kilometers, and stay in one location for a maximum of 3 nights.
This rule is not a legal regulation but rather a philosophy for sustainable and enjoyable RV travel, encouraging a slower pace to truly appreciate local areas and prevent driver fatigue. It also assists in managing fuel costs by limiting daily mileage.
Adhering to the 333 rule is particularly beneficial in North Europe, where the diverse landscapes—from coastal fjords to vast forests—can be fully appreciated without rushing. It also allows for better adaptation to potentially varied road conditions and the unique light cycles, such as extreme daylight or prolonged darkness.

Can you sleep anywhere in a campervan in Europe
The ability to sleep anywhere in a campervan across Europe varies significantly due to differing wild camping laws, with North European countries offering unique freedoms alongside stricter regulations elsewhere.
Countries like Sweden, Norway, and Finland, for instance, permit overnight stays in many natural areas under the principle of 'Allemansrätten' (the Right to Roam), allowing campers to stay for a night or two, provided they respect privacy and leave no trace.
Conversely, Denmark and most Baltic countries, including Estonia, Latvia, and Lithuania, have stricter regulations. In these areas, overnight stays are often limited to designated campsites or specific parking zones, with wild camping generally prohibited or heavily restricted.
Even within countries that permit wild camping, RVs must adhere to specific rules, such as maintaining a respectful distance from private dwellings, avoiding cultivated land, and ensuring no environmental impact. It is always crucial to check local signage and bylaws upon arrival, as individual municipalities or natural parks may have their own specific regulations.

Is Europe RV friendly
Europe is generally considered RV-friendly, boasting extensive infrastructure that supports motorhome travel. However, North Europe presents a unique blend of challenges and unparalleled travel benefits for RV enthusiasts.
While excellent roads connect major cities, rural North European routes can often be narrower, and the utilization of ferry systems is frequently crucial for exploring islands and fjords, particularly in Norway. Careful route planning is essential.
North Europe’s infrastructure generally supports RVs with a good network of campsites and service points, although distances between these services can be greater in more remote areas. This necessitates a degree of self-sufficiency and preparedness.
The region is particularly appealing for RV travelers seeking unique adventures like chasing the Northern Lights, exploring dramatic fjords, or experiencing the midnight sun. Vehicles are often equipped for colder weather and varied terrain, enhancing the travel experience.
Specific considerations for North Europe include preparing for extreme daylight or darkness conditions, navigating diverse languages, and budgeting for potentially higher fuel and toll costs. Despite these, the rewards of exploring these stunning regions by RV are immense.
What is the typical price range for a luxury RV
The rental price range for a luxury RV in North Europe is quite extensive, typically starting from €1,000–€1,500 per week during the low season and escalating to €3,500–€5,000+ per week during the peak summer months of July and August.
This pricing is dictated by factors such as the RV's brand (e.g., Morelo, Concorde), its class (integrated A-class versus high-end campervan), age, and specific features crucial for North European conditions, like robust insulation and heated tanks.
Luxury RVs are characterized by their high-end finishes, advanced technology, spacious interiors, and enhanced comfort features, which collectively justify their premium rental cost.
